Strong's Greek Bible Dictionary

τολμάω

tolmavw

tolmao

{tol-mah'-o}

from tolma (boldness; probably itself from the base of 5056 through the idea of extreme conduct); to venture (objectively or in act; while 2292 is rather subjective or in feeling); by implication, to be courageous:--be bold, boldly, dare, durst.
